More drama at the theatre today! We were cleaning up and getting the stage set up for tech rehearsal when a barefoot woman wandered onto the stage and started placing water bottles with the theatre logo onto the furniture. After several exchanges of "who is that?" amongst us a stage manager engaged her in conversation while a production manager called security. Everything was calm until the security guard told her she needed to leave. At that point she raced for the upstage exit and was caught by a couple of stagehands right next to some very expensive projection equipment. It took 3-4 guys to carry her through the wings and hold her in the stairwell until the police arrived. It seems she had been wandering the building most of the morning.
